Salman Khan fondly known as Bhai turned 53 yesterday and every one from his close to his fans all wished the superstar. Celebrities like Sushmita Sen and Katrina Kaif were present at his birthday bash and made his birthday a memorable affair. But fans missed Shah Rukh Khan at the bash. However, a video showing the Ra one actor singing the hit number, “Pyaar hume kis mod pe le aaya" with Salman Khan went viral this morning.

However SRK was not present at birthday bash but he made sure he celebrated Salman’s birthday in his own way. The actor was recently seen addressing a gathering wherein he wished Salman. SRK sang, “happy birthday to you,” for Salman despite his absence from the venue.

On the workfornt, SRK was last seen in the zero which got the mixed response from the audience. However audience loved the performances of the lead stars, the story failed to impress them.

Talking about Salman, will next be seen in 'Bharat' along with Katrina Kaif. he film has an ensemble star cast with the likes of Disha Patani, Sunil Grover, Aasif Shaikh and Tabu,'Bharat' is slated for an Eid 2019 release.
